#5CFFF9 Hex Color Code

#5CFFF9

The Hexadecimal Color #5CFFF9 is a contrast shade of Aqua Marine. #5CFFF9 RGB value is rgb(92, 255, 249). RGB Color Model of #5CFFF9 consists of 36% red, 100% green and 97% blue. HSL color Mode of #5CFFF9 has 178°(degrees) Hue, 100% Saturation and 68% Lightness. #5CFFF9 color has an wavelength of 507.92593n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#5CFFF9 is #66FFFF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#5CFFF9 is #5FF. The Closest Color to #5CFFF9 is #7FFFD4. Official Name of #5CFFF9 Hex Code is Turquoise Blue.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#5CFFF9 is 64 Cyan 0 Magenta 2 Yellow 0 Black and #5CFFF9 CMY is 64, 0, 2.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#5CFFF9 is hsl(178,100,68,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(178, 64, 100).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#5CFFF9 is 57.26, 80.63, 102.15.
Hex8 Value of #5CFFF9 is #5CFFF9FF. Decimal Value of #5CFFF9 is 6094841 and Octal Value of #5CFFF9 is 27177771. Binary Value of #5CFFF9 is 1011100, 11111111, 11111001 and Android of #5CFFF9 is 4284284921 / 0xff5cfff9.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#5CFFF9 is 0.239, 0.336, 0.336 and YIQ Color Space of #5CFFF9 is 205.579, -95.2039, -36.3417.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#5CFFF9 is 60.01, 97.2, 101.72.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#5CFFF9 is 91.97, -43.09, -9.64.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#5CFFF9 is 91.97, -62.46, -8.45.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#5CFFF9 is 91.97, 44.16, 192.61. Hunter Lab variable of #5CFFF9 is 89.79, -43.31, -4.59.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#5CFFF9

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
